<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8" ?> <!-- for emacs: -*- coding: utf-8 -*- --> <!-- Apache may like this line in the file .htaccess: AddCharset utf-8 .html --> <!DOCTYPE html P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D XHTML 1.1 plus MathML 2.0 plus SVG 1.1//EN" "http://www.w3.org/2002/04/xhtml-math-svg/xhtml-math-svg-flat.dtd" > <html x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ml" xml:lang="en"> <head><title>path -- list of directories to look in</title> <link rel="stylesheet" type="text/css" href="../../../../Macaulay2/Style/doc.css"/> </head> <body> <table class="buttons"> <tr> <td><div><a href="_quit.html">next</a> | <a href="_process__I__D.html">previous</a> | <a href="_quit.html">forward</a> | <a href="_process__I__D.html">backward</a> | <a href="_system_spfacilities.html">up</a> | <a href="index.html">top</a> | <a href="master.html">index</a> | <a href="toc.html">toc</a> | <a href="http://www.math.uiuc.edu/Macaulay2/">Macaulay2 web site</a></div> </td> </tr> </table> <div><a href="index.html" title="">Macaulay2Doc</a> > <a href="___The_sp__Macaulay2_splanguage.html" title="">The Macaulay2 language</a> > <a href="_system_spfacilities.html" title="">system facilities</a> > <a href="_path.html" title="list of directories to look in">path</a></div> <hr/> <div><h1>path -- list of directories to look in</h1> <div class="single"><h2>Description</h2> <div><p>A list of strings containing names of directories in which <a href="_load.html" title="read Macaulay2 commands">load</a>, <a href="_input.html" title="read Macaulay2 commands and echo">input</a>, <a href="_load__Package.html" title="load a package">loadPackage</a>, <a href="_needs__Package.html" title="load a package if not already loaded">needsPackage</a>, and <a href="_install__Package.html" title="load and install a package and its documentation ">installPackage</a> should seek files. These strings are simply concatenated with the filename being sought, so should include a terminal slash. One further directory is implicitly searched first: the directory containing the current input file; when input is coming from the standard input, that directory is the current directory of the process.</p> <p>After the core Macaulay2 files are loaded, unless the command line option <tt>-q</tt> is encountered, the following subdirectories will be prepended to the path, based on the value of the <a href="_application__Directory.html" title="the path to the user's application directory">applicationDirectory</a> for your system.</p> <pre> /builddir/.Macaulay2/code/ /builddir/.Macaulay2/local/share/Macaulay2/ /builddir/.Macaulay2/local/common/share/Macaulay2/</pre> <table class="examples"><tr><td><pre>i1 : path o1 = {./, /builddir/build/BUILD/Macaulay2-1.3.1-r10737/Macaulay2/packages/, ------------------------------------------------------------------------ /builddir/build/BUILD/Macaulay2-1.3.1-r10737/StagingArea/common/share/ ------------------------------------------------------------------------ Macaulay2/} o1 : List</pre> </td></tr> <tr><td><pre>i2 : path = append(path, "~/resolutions/") o2 = {./, /builddir/build/BUILD/Macaulay2-1.3.1-r10737/Macaulay2/packages/, ------------------------------------------------------------------------ /builddir/build/BUILD/Macaulay2-1.3.1-r10737/StagingArea/common/share/ ------------------------------------------------------------------------ Macaulay2/, ~/resolutions/} o2 : List</pre> </td></tr> </table> </div> </div> <div class="waystouse"><h2>For the programmer</h2> <p>The object <a href="_path.html" title="list of directories to look in">path</a> is <span>a <a href="___List.html">list</a></span>.</p> </div> </div> </body> </html>
